Motorists are advised of changed traffic conditions on the Newell Highway at Grong Grong this month for essential road work. 

Single lane closures will be in place on the Newell Highway between Gawnes and Connells roads to rebuild and widen the highway to provide a safer road.

Work will be carried out Mondays to Saturdays between 7am and 6pm from Tuesday 27 January and is expected to be completed in mid-April, weather permitting.

For the safety of workers and road users, the Henwood Rest Area will be closed for the duration of the project. Road users will instead be able to stop at Firetail Rest Area or Narrandera truck parking bay.

Traffic control and reduced speed limits of 40 km/h will be in place for the duration of the project to guide road users through the work zone.
